For both new residents and old-timers alike, Warren A to Z takes you on an
informative tour of Warren Township including the land, places, people,
issues, and events that have shaped "the greenest place in New Jersey."


Almost from its beginning 275 years ago, Warren was a scattering of small
villages that included only a post office or church, general store, a
blacksmith shop, tavern, and a few houses. Like many other communities in
fast-growing Somerset County, Warren Township has changed dramatically
during the last half century. Gone are the shimmering fields of hay and
corn, the sheep and cows grazing in the sun, and the weather-beaten barns.
Author and historian Alan A. Siegel arranges his entries alphabetically in
an easy-to-read format as he explains how the forested mountains and
pastoral valley have given way to progress. In 1982, there were still 150
working farms in Warren, but now almost all are gone-victims of the very
charm of the surroundings that have attracted so many newcomers.


Warren A to Z will transport you on a fabulous historical journey that
highlights the churches and schools, noteworthy buildings, famous people,
and political movements of this beautiful area nestled in the Watchung
Mountains.
